summ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orzan2020-07-20 00:09:27 -0400
committerzan2020-07-20 00:09:27 -0400
commit4b4feab9d127d7c19b5937f23e4f3811f09ba9f9 (patch)
treea8f760d9fccd0555349369b96cf3e199ba29dccc
parenta078d4b26ffa0216117ab9c886fbad18e82f0fff (diff)
downloadaur-4b4feab9d127d7c19b5937f23e4f3811f09ba9f9.tar.gz
invent.kde migration
-rw-r--r--.SRCINFO22
-rw-r--r--PKGBUILD39
2 files changed, 24 insertions, 37 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 23f33c872e0d..fa17385243f3 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,26 +1,22 @@
-# Generated by mksrcinfo v8
-# Fri Jun 24 01:31:18 UTC 2016
pkgbase = baloo-git
pkgdesc = A framework for searching and managing metadata
- pkgver = r2021.db8b416
- pkgrel = 2
- url = https://projects.kde.org/projects/kde/kdelibs/baloo
- install = baloo-git.install
- arch = i686
+ pkgver = v5.71.0.rc1.r7.ga0b53673
+ pkgrel = 1
+ url = https://invent.kde.org/frameworks/baloo
arch = x86_64
groups = kf5
license = LGPL
- makedepends = extra-cmake-modules-git
+ makedepends = extra-cmake-modules
makedepends = git
- makedepends = kdoctools-git
+ makedepends = kdoctools
makedepends = python
depends = lmdb
- depends = kfilemetadata-git
- depends = kidletime-git
- depends = kio-git
+ depends = kfilemetadata
+ depends = kidletime
+ depends = kio
provides = baloo
conflicts = baloo
- source = git://anongit.kde.org/baloo.git
+ source = git+https://invent.kde.org/frameworks/baloo.git
md5sums = SKIP
pkgname = baloo-git
diff --git a/PKGBUILD b/PKGBUILD
index 7e7963397e35..5b322650c6a9 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,42 +1,33 @@
-# Maintainer: Antonio Rojas <arojas@archlinux.org>
+# Maintainer: zan <zan@420blaze.it>
+# Contributor: Antonio Rojas <arojas@archlinux.org>
# Contributor: Andrea Scarpino <andrea@archlinux.org>
pkgname=baloo-git
-pkgver=r2021.db8b416
-pkgrel=2
+_name=${pkgname%-git}
+pkgver=v5.71.0.rc1.r7.ga0b53673
+pkgrel=1
pkgdesc="A framework for searching and managing metadata"
-arch=(i686 x86_64)
-url='https://projects.kde.org/projects/kde/kdelibs/baloo'
+arch=(x86_64)
+url='https://invent.kde.org/frameworks/baloo'
license=(LGPL)
-depends=(lmdb kfilemetadata-git kidletime-git kio-git)
-makedepends=(extra-cmake-modules-git git kdoctools-git python)
+depends=(lmdb kfilemetadata kidletime kio)
+makedepends=(extra-cmake-modules git kdoctools python)
groups=(kf5)
provides=(baloo)
conflicts=(baloo)
-install=$pkgname.install
-source=('git://anongit.kde.org/baloo.git')
+source=("git+https://invent.kde.org/frameworks/$_name.git")
md5sums=('SKIP')
pkgver() {
- cd baloo
- print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
-}
-
-prepare() {
- mkdir -p build
+ cd $_name
+ git describe --long | sed 's/\([^-]*-g\)/r\1/;s/-/./g'
}
build() {
- cd build
- cmake ../baloo \
- -DCMAKE_BUILD_TYPE=Release \
- -DCMAKE_INSTALL_PREFIX=/usr \
- -DKDE_INSTALL_LIBDIR=lib \
- -DKDE_INSTALL_USE_QT_SYS_PATHS=ON
- make
+ cmake -B build -S $_name
+ cmake --build build
}
package() {
- cd build
- make DESTDIR="$pkgdir" install
+ DESTDIR="$pkgdir" cmake --install build
}